Founded in 1902 by immigrants from Nola, Italy, just east of Naples, Bamonte's is one of the city's oldest continuously operating restaurants, the setting for numerous TV episodes and films, and it shows every year of its venerable age. Dubrows Cafeteria, Kings Highway and East 16th Street, Midwood Opened in 1939, this Jewish dairy restaurant was the flagship of a chain that, in its heyday, had branches in Brooklyn, Manhattan, and Miami. Located in the historic village of Gravesend the only one of the six original towns of Brooklyn that was English rather than Dutch Joe's has occupied this space in the shadow of the F tracks since the early 1960s, and the Naugahyde and Formica dcor attest to it. The original Yemen Cafe was founded in downtown Brooklyn on Atlantic Avenue in 1981 (and is still there), but this branch sprang up a decade ago, as Yemeni businesses migrated to Bay Ridge. Near the end of the 19th century, Italian-America cuisine was invented by housewives from regions like Campania, Apulia, and Sicily who arrived in America to find many of the ingredients they were accustomed to cooking with simply not available. The restaurant was famous for its turtle soup which took three days to make and other specialties included Welsh rarebit, broiled clams, steaks and chops, and crab meat la Dewey, a rich dish of lump crab, cream, and mushrooms. The inside is tricked out like a Caucasus village, much of the baking is done on the premises, and the menu includes all the Georgian classics, from adjaruli khachapuri and puckered khinkali dumplings to herb-bearing meat stews like veal chakapuli. La Sorrentina (6522 11th Avenue, Dyker Heights, 718-680-9299) Though this place only dates to the 1980s, it seems much older in its versions of Italian-American standards, from beans with escarole soup, to tripe stewed with potatoes, to grooved cavatelli with ground-beef sauce. After the R train arrived in 1916, the floodgates opened, and today there are substantial Italian, Arab, Greek, Chinese, Irish, and Turkish communities, and a population that hovers around 80,000.
